HIGH SCHOOL ROUNDUP: Luke Rodgers has career night for Sandwich boys basketball win

Amandine Durivage of St. John Paul II reacts after a steal by Susannah Brown of Monomoy.

Luke Rodgers recorded a career-high 25 points for Sandwich boys basketball team in a 82-60 win over Hull on Tuesday. Dan Oman scored 17 points, Connor Finn added 12 points and six assists, and Cole Rodgers contributed 11 points for Sandwich (6-6).

In other high school action:

Boys Basketball

St. John Paul II 72, Rising Tide 43: The Lions (2-10) picked up their second win of the season as Matt Curley scored a game high of 33 points. Brandon Gomes chipped in 11 points, while Daniel Cordeiro added 10 points for JPII.

Nantucket 58, Monomoy 43: The Whalers (10-6) snapped a two-game slide, while the Sharks lost back-to-back games for the first time this season.

Cape Tech 62, Bristol Aggie 44: The Crusaders (8-8) are back to .500 on the season as they snapped a two game losing streak.

Blue Hills 63, Upper Cape 58: The Rams (10-4) ended a three-game win streak with the loss.

Nauset 57, Falmouth 53 (OT): The Warriors (5-8) have won two straight, while the Clippers (4-9) have dropped two straight games.

Randolph 49, Mashpee 48: After the Falcons (7-9) trailed by nine midway through the fourth quarter, they came back and tied the game with 15 seconds left. Randolph stole the ball, and knocked down one of two free throws that sealed the win.

Girls Basketball

Falmouth 54, Nauset 24: The Clippers (8-5) have won two of their last three games, while the Warriors (6-8) have dropped three of the last four. Teagan Lind led the way with a game high of 23 points, while Skylar Plourde and Hailey Lynch each added five points for Falmouth.

Sandwich 68, Hull 45: After their first loss of the season last game, the Blue Knights (12-1) bounced back with a win. Junior Ayla Whitney finished with six points and five rebounds, while sophomore Hannah Sareault added six points and four rebounds for Sandwich.;

Falmouth Academy 25, Sturgis West 23 (OT): The Mariners (8-4) pulled off the overtime victory over the Navigators (3-7). Willow Lajoie led the team with seven points, while Maria Soares added six points for Falmouth Academy.

Monomoy 50, St. John Paul II 49 (OT): The Sharks (7-7) have won back-to-back games for the second time, while the Lions (11-4) six game win streak ended. Susannah Brown had a double double of 14 points and 13 rebounds for Monomoy.

Nantucket 53, Rising Tide 18: After a 1-6 start to the season, the Whalers (6-6) have won five games in a row.

Upper Cape 50, Norfolk Aggie 31: The Rams (10-2) remained hot with their ninth straight win.

Bristol Aggie 46, Cape Tech 43: The Crusaders (6-10) came up just short at home.

Boys Swimming

Sandwich 82, Nauset 76: The Blue Knights picked up the win over the Warriors. Nauset's 200 Free Relay team qualified for sectionals, while the 400 Free Relay team qualified for States. Will Crowell also qualified for States in the 100 Butterfly.

Girls Swimming

Nauset 103, Sandwich 66: The Warriors swam to a victory over the Blue Knights. Izzy Hardwicke qualified for Sectionals in the 200 Free, while Laura Kaser qualified for Sectionals in the 200 IM for Nauset.
